THE STARTER REPORTED: a) WHAT A BOLT (A Andrews) stood awkwardly in the stalls and jumped slow, losing two lengths. THE STIPENDIARY STEWARDS REPORTED: a) BONANZA (D Ashby), which was hanging in throughout, rolled in leaving the 400m and became unbalanced while being steadied away from the heels of TRANSACT (R Fourie). Thereafter BONANZA (D Ashby) continued to hang in, proved difficult to assist and gave ground to the field. The veterinary surgeon was requested to examine this gelding. b) Jockey A Andrews reported WHAT A BOLT did not stride out freely in running and he did not persevere with his riding in the latter stages. The veterinary surgeon was requested to examine this gelding. c) DOUBLE CHARGE, the winner, was selected for the taking of specimens for analysis. Trainer WA Nel was advised. (TJ) JOCKEY AND/OR EQUIPMENT CHANGES: a) Nil RACE CARD CHANGES / OTHER a) Nil THE VETERINARY SURGEON REPORTED: a) BONANZA - examined post-race. Lame left front. Veterinary report required prior to acceptances. Rule 49.7 applies b) TRANSACT - blowing post-race c) WHAT A BOLT - shin sore right front. Veterinary report required prior to acceptances. Rule 49.7 applies THERE WERE NO SCRATCHINGS.
